Core Technologies in High-End Agricultural Drones
1. RTK Precision Positioning System
RTK (Real-Time Kinematic) technology enables centimeter-level positioning accuracy, which is essential for precision agriculture.
Benefits:
- Extremely accurate flight paths
- Reduced overlap in spraying
- Improved chemical efficiency
- Better crop protection results
2. AI-Based Flight Planning
High-end drones use AI systems to:
- Automatically analyze field size
- Generate optimized flight routes
- Adjust spraying density in real time
- Avoid obstacles dynamically
This reduces human error and increases efficiency.
3. Intelligent Spraying System
Modern systems include:
- Variable droplet control
- Smart pressure regulation
- Wind compensation algorithms
- Targeted spraying zones
This ensures chemicals are applied only where needed.
4. High-Payload Drone Architecture
High-end agricultural drones often support 30L to 50L payload systems, allowing them to cover large areas quickly.
Advantages:
- Higher efficiency per flight
- Reduced number of takeoffs
- Lower operational time cost
5. Obstacle Avoidance System
Advanced sensors include:
- Radar systems
- LiDAR modules
- Vision-based AI detection
These systems prevent collisions with trees, poles, and terrain.

Key Performance Factors in High-End Agricultural Drones
1. Flight Stability
High-end drones must operate in:
- Strong wind conditions
- Uneven terrain
- Large-scale farmland environments
Stability directly impacts spraying accuracy.
2. Spraying Precision
Precision is measured by:
- Droplet size consistency
- Coverage uniformity
- Chemical efficiency
3. Battery Efficiency
High-performance batteries should offer:
- Long flight time
- Fast charging
- High cycle durability
4. Software Intelligence
Modern drones rely heavily on software systems for:
- Route optimization
- Real-time adjustments
- Data analysis
5. Durability and Environmental Resistance
High-end drones must withstand:
- Heat
- Moisture
- Dust
- Chemical corrosion
